Class Teacher - Specialist SEMH Setting (Full-Time, Permanent) 🌟 Job Title: Class Teacher Grade: Teachers Main Pay - UPR + SEN (£2,679) Area: Rochdale, Greater Manchester Start Date: November 2025 Contract Type: Full-time, Permanent (All Year Round) Salary: £31,650 - £49,084 + SEN £2,679 Working Pattern: All Year Round 📅 Closing date: Thursday 2nd October 2025 Interview Date: Week commencing 6th October 2025 🏫 About the school: A nurturing and inclusive specialist SEMH setting for Key Stage 2 to 4 learners with Education, Health and Care Plans (EHCPs). Our mission is simple yet powerful - to provide a safe, empowering environment where every young person is supported to grow in confidence, heal from challenges, and thrive in life and learning. Opening in September 2025, they are building a passionate, dedicated team who want to shape a new future for children with Social, Emotional and Mental Health (SEMH) needs. This is your chance to play a pivotal role in creating a school that puts relationships, well-being, and opportunity at its heart. 🧩 About the Role: Teach a broad and balanced curriculum within our nurturing pathway for pupils in Key Stages 2-4 Use trauma-informed and relational approaches to build trust and engagement Focus on developing pupils' emotional well-being, social skills, and readiness to learn Work in partnership with colleagues, families, and professionals to support each child's unique journey Contribute to the creation of a warm, inclusive learning environment where every young person feels valuedWhat We're Looking For: A qualified teacher with knowledge of the KS2-4 curriculum Experience of working with pupils with SEMH and additional needs A compassionate, patient, and resilient approach to teaching and behaviour support Creativity and flexibility to design learning that truly engages pupils Excellent communication and teamwork skillsTo Be Eligible You Must: Hold the Right to Work in the UK Have QTS (or equivalent) and be able to evidence your qualifications Hold or be willing to apply for an enhanced child barred list DBS certificate Provide two professional child-related references Be confident communicating with pupils, families, and colleagues in accurate spoken English📝 Please submit your up-to-date CV to be considered.
